如何用我独特的文字替换数字?让我们说代替1.,2.,3。我想把Bla,Blabla,Blablabla。
http://i.stack.imgur.com/kf0p4.jpg
<style>
#menu2 {
width: 320px;
}
#menu2 ol {
font-style: talic;
font-family: Georgia, serif;
font-size: 24px;
color: #bfe1f1;
}
#menu2 ol li p {
padding:8px;
font-style: normal;
font-family: Arial;
font-size: 13px;
color: #eee;
text-align:left;
border-left: 1px solid #999;
}
#menu2 ol li p em {
display: block;
}
</style>
<div id="menu2">
<ol>
<li><p><em>Jeden</em> Sed diam eu dui dolor, porttitor laoreet fermentum. Morbi laoreet, enim aliquam convallis. Donec ullamcorper, augue euismod convallis nisl. Etiam dictum sit amet tempus arcu.</p></li>
<li><p><em>Dwa</em> Sed diam eu dui dolor, porttitor laoreet fermentum. Morbi laoreet, enim aliquam convallis. Donec ullamcorper, augue euismod convallis nisl. Etiam dictum sit amet tempus arcu.</p></li>
<li><p><em>Trzy</em> Sed diam eu dui dolor, porttitor laoreet fermentum. Morbi laoreet, enim aliquam convallis. Donec ullamcorper, augue euismod convallis nisl. Etiam dictum sit amet tempus arcu.</p></li>
<li><p><em>Cztery</em> Sed diam eu dui dolor, porttitor laoreet fermentum. Morbi laoreet, enim aliquam convallis. Donec ullamcorper, augue euismod convallis nisl. Etiam dictum sit amet tempus arcu.</p></li>
</ol>
</div>
答案 0 :(得分:-1)
这有点ha ..
如果要将数字替换为您想要的任何数字,首先要删除列表样式类型。
ul {
list-style-type: none;
}
接下来,使用:before
伪以及:nth-child
来定位标记。
其中content: " "
是列表项之前的文本。
li:before {
content: "ugh";
padding-right:10px;
}
li:nth-child(2):before {
content:"blah";
}
li:nth-child(3):before {
content:"foo";
}
<强> jsFiddle here. 强>